Where do genital warts appear?

In women and men, warts may appear in groin, on and around the genitals, urethra, rectum, or anus. Women: Genital warts may appear around the anus or on the vulva, vagina, or cervix. Women often don’t know about warts in the vagina or on the cervix until doctors discover them.

What do genital warts look like when they first appear?

What do genital warts look like?genital warts look like Small flesh-colored, pink, or red growths in or around the sex organs. Warts may look similar to small pieces of cauliflower, or they may be very small and difficult to see. They usually appear in groups of three or four and may grow and spread rapidly.

Will I get genital warts forever?

While HPV is not curable in all cases, genital warts are treatable.You can also go for a long time without breaking out, but May not get rid of warts forever. This is because condyloma acuminatum is only one symptom of HPV, which can become a chronic, lifelong infection in some people.

How does condyloma acuminatum feel to the touch?

The surface of condyloma acuminatum may be bumpy or rough when touched. They are often described as having a « cauliflower » appearance. Genital warts may appear as single bumps, or they may grow in small clusters. Over time, additional warts may appear.

Does HPV show up in blood tests?

Unfortunately, No swab or blood test for HPV. The doctor/clinic’s sexual health screening (routine test) cannot detect skin viruses, HPV or HSV (genital herpes). HPV can only be diagnosed when a person has visible warts on the skin of their genitals or an abnormal Pap smear result.

Does everyone carry HPV?

HPV is so common that Almost everyone who is sexually active will get HPV at some point in their life if they have not had the HPV vaccine. Health problems associated with HPV include genital warts and cervical cancer.

Can you prove who gave you HPV?

Evidence is hard to come by For HPV infection, because although some strains can cause cancer and warts, there are usually no symptoms. The virus is usually cleared by the body without the infected person knowing that they have ever been infected with the virus.
